Hi there! I'm a University of Missouri alum (Go Tigers!) I received my Bachelor of Journalism with a focus on Strategic Communications and a minor in Business Administration. I have always had a desire to help others and to impart knowledge in an engaging way (giving tours at art museums, spending my summers leading classes for students, volunteering at schools to tutor) and that culminated in me joining Teach For America to teach Mathematics for 3 years. While I do have a penchant for writing, my love for math has been ever-present and I enjoy helping people to understand mathematics as the problem-solving discipline that it is. I feel comfortable teaching anything through 11th grade Mathematics. My teaching philosophy is that all questions are good questions if they get you closer to understanding and that wrong answers are valuable to learning. Most proficiency comes from gaining confidence, so I try to give as many at-bats with the subject matter as it takes for a student to feel confident!
